Damascus (ST): The Syrian Arab News Agency (SANA) won the competition of the Union of Mediterranean News Agencies (Aman) for the best news and best picture for the period between 2021-2022.
The Board of Directors of the Federation announced, during its online meeting, the name of the winner of the best news competition for the period between 2021-2022, which is the article written by the journalist Muhammad Imad Al-Daghli from the Syrian Arab News Agency, entitled “Syrians werethe first to invent seals in the world,” which talked about seals through the ages. It is one of the most important archaeological finds from which the researcher in archeology derives his information about Syria, the pristine land of the oldest discovered seals in the world.
It is noteworthy that SANA Agency wins the award for the best news for the second time, as it won first place in 2015.
